Voice Check (reactive scan)
Scan a file for AI writing patterns and tone violations. Fix every issue found, then report what you changed.
Process
- Read
../../references/rules.md for the full rule list (the file lives at the plugin root, not inside the skill dir)
- Determine the target file path
- Walk up from the target file to the git root, looking for
.claude/voice-check.md at each level. Stop at the first one found. Do not aggregate across levels.
- Load the supplement if found
- Read the target file
- Scan against the rules + supplement
- Auto-fix mode (default for /voice-check): rewrite the file in place
- Report-only mode (when called from the pre-commit hook): print findings, do not modify the file
- Report a summary of changes by category
